Funimation completes Crunchyroll acquisition

Sony Pictures Entertainment (SPE) and AT&T have confirmed that SPE has completed its acquisition of AT&T’s Crunchyroll anime business through Funimation Global Group. Funimation is a joint venture between SPE and Sony Music Entertainment (Japan) subsidiary, Aniplex Inc. The agreement was first announced in December 2020. Netflix revenue up 52% in Spain

2020 was a prosperous year for Netflix in Spain; its subsidiary, Los Gatos Entretenimiento, increased its revenues by 52 per cent to €11.8 million reporting a net benefit of €653.822, up 26 per cent – but far below the global growth of the streaming platform.
